A leading motorsports organization is seeking an experienced Business Analyst to bridge business needs with technology solutions in a dynamic environment. The role involves collaborating across teams to gather and document requirements, improve operational effectiveness, and participate in testing and validation activities.
Candidates should have a Bachelor's degree, relevant certification, and experience in stakeholder management. This position offers competitive benefits and opportunities for personal and professional growth.
